detractors

英 [dɪˈtræktəz]

美 [dɪˈtræktərz]

n.  诋毁者; 贬低者; 恶意批评者
detractor的复数

柯林斯词典

  • N-COUNT 诋毁者;贬低者;诽谤者
    Thedetractorsof a person or thing are people who criticize that person or thing.
    1. This performance will silence many of his detractors...
      这一表演将会让很多诋毁他的人闭嘴。
    2. The news will have delighted detractors of the scheme.
      这条消息会让该方案的批评者感到高兴。
